Theler Kobra MD - "Last of the Gotha V-Strutters"
Role: Scout
Served With: Gotha Empire, Fokker
First Flight: 1595
Strengths: Heavily Armed
Weaknesses: Handling & Reliability
Inspiration: Albatros D.V (1917)
Description:
The Kobra was obsolete by the end of the war, but so much of Gotha’s infrastructure was built around them that replacing it entirely wasn’t seen as feasible. Theler’s outsized influence meant that even though the Empire had finally secured the castor oil, the new Kobra mark entered service.
The Kobra MD’s overcompressed Bertha F1466 powerplant required manual benzene injections just to start, and had a tendency to blow their cylinders through the valvetrain if you flooded the carburettor. Furthermore, the prototype still suffered wing twisting issues, an embarrassment when most Kreuzer designs were using cantilevers.
It’s generally believed that the Theler corporation essentially executed a coup of the Gotha Empire in order to preserve their order.

Queer Horror Stories to Celebrate Mary Shelley’s Birthday!
Today, August 30th, is Frankenstein Day and Mary Shelley’s Birthday! To celebrate the first horror novel, we decided to ask our contributors about their favorite queer horror novels and ended up with 28 titles for a very spooky end of summer. Contributors to this list are: Shadaras, D.V. Morse, Nova Mason, Terra P. Waters, Rhosyn Goodfellow, Nina Waters, Meera S., Shea Sullivan, Owl Outerbridge, Sanne, Tris Lawrence, boneturtle and an anonymous contributor.
The Luminous Dead by Caitlin Starling
Someone You Can Build a Nest In by John Wiswell
The Devourers by Indra Das
Into the Drowning Deep & Rolling in the Deep (Rolling in the Deep series) by Mira Grant
What Moves the Dead (Sworn Soldier series) by T. Kingfisher
Bury Your Gays by Chuck Tingle
Camp Damascus by Chuck Tingle
I Feed Her to the Beast and the Beast Is Me by Jamison Shea
Sixteen Souls by Rosie Talbot
The Honeys by Ryan La Sala
The Taking of Jake Livingston by Ryan Douglass
Kaleidoscope of Death by Xi Zi Xu
The Dead and the Dark by Courtney Gould
Alice Isn’t Dead by Joseph Fink
Squad by Maggie Tokuda-Hall
The Hills of Estrella Roja by Ashley Robin Franklin
The Vampire Lestat (The Vampire Chronicles series) by Anne Rice
The Picture of Dorian Gray by Oscar Wilde
The Summer Hikaru Died by Mokumokuren
Pet Shop of Horrors by Matsuri Akino
Your Shadow Half Remains by Sunny Moraine
The Deep Sky by Yume Kitasei
Make the Exorcist Fall in Love by Aruma Arima & Masuku Fukayama
Hell Followed With Us by Andrew Joseph White
Summer Sons by Lee Mandelo
Fate/Stay Night by Type-Moon
Umineko When They Cry by Ryukishi07
Case 00: The Cannibal Boy from Sounding Stone
Welcome to Night Vale
The Silt Verses
